Howard is a village in Brown and Outagamie counties in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. The population was 19,950 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Green Bay Metropolitan Statistical Area . Course. Duck Creek begins in the rural areas north of Blue Grass and it empties into the Mississippi River between Bettendorf and Riverdale. At 19 miles (31 km) [1] long it is the largest creek in the Quad Cities and is mainly used for storm water runoff. [2] Duck Creek's watershed covers a total of 40,294 acres (16,306 ha). [1]

Par. 65. Length. 4,886 yards (4,468 m) Rock Creek Park Golf Course (also known as Rock Creek Golf Course) is a golf course located in Washington, D.C., in the United States. The entire course lies within Rock Creek Park, a national park owned and maintained by the National Park Service division of the United States Department of the Interior .
